Advanced Manufacturing Architecture

Modern plastic processing demands machines that deliver high throughput, low wear, and absolute thermal control. In extrusion systems, polymer rheology dictates that the temperature distribution inside the barrel must be controlled to within ±1°C. Wenzhou Yicai Machinery addresses this requirement by implementing bimetallic barrels and high L/D (Length-to-Diameter) ratio single and multi-screw systems. This ensures homogeneous melting, eliminates shear stress defects, and enables uniform output across multi-layer co-extruded sheet lines.

Additionally, our equipment incorporates closed-loop feedback control interfaces. By partnering with leading component manufacturers (including Siemens, Omron, Delta, and Schneider), our thermoforming and extrusion lines integrate real-time tracking, remote diagnostics, and energy-saving protocols. This level of optimization minimizes material degradation, speeds up cycle times, and reduces power consumption by up to 25% compared to legacy machinery.

Extrusion Machine Process: Technical Context and Trends

1. Industry Development & Tech Evolution

The global plastics extrusion market is transitioning from simple structural profiles to complex co-extruded barrier layers. Driven by circular economy targets, modern plastic packaging requires thinner barriers that perform exceptionally well. Techniques such as multi-layer co-extrusion enable manufacturers to combine recycled core layers with pristine virgin outer layers, maximizing material efficiency.

Additionally, processing bio-plastics (like PLA, PBAT, and PHA) introduces challenging rheological properties and narrow temperature margins. Modern extrusion systems incorporate specialized screw designs and moisture venting technologies to handle bio-polymers without compromising structural stability.

Extrusion & Thermoforming Q&A

Expert technical insights regarding machine configuration, operation, and efficiency

What is the purpose of multi-layer co-extrusion in plastic processing?
Multi-layer co-extrusion merges different polymer layers (such as PP, PE, EVOH, and recycled materials) into a single sheet. This method enables manufacturers to place recycled plastic in the center layer (A-B-A configuration) while keeping food-safe virgin material on the surfaces. It improves barrier protection against oxygen and moisture, increases mechanical strength, and reduces raw material costs.
How does the online edge material crusher improve material efficiency?
During sheet thermoforming, up to 30% of the material remains as scrap edge trimmings. The online edge material crusher grinds these trimmings instantly and feeds them back into the extruder feed throat. This continuous loop prevents contamination, maintains thermal consistency, and lowers raw material waste to under 2%.
What factors are critical when processing biodegradable resins like PLA?
PLA is highly sensitive to moisture and thermal breakdown. Successful processing requires a specialized crystallization dryer to prevent hydrolytic degradation, along with custom screw designs that prevent excessive shear heating. Precise temperature profiling (typically keeping within ±1°C) is required to prevent viscosity loss.
What are the key benefits of servo-driven thermoforming over hydraulic systems?
Servo-driven systems offer higher precision, faster cycle speeds, and increased energy efficiency. They allow programmable mold stroke profiles, reduce mechanical wear compared to hydraulic counterparts, and lower power consumption by up to 30%, while eliminating the risk of oil leaks.
